Just get some spacers (I used nylon) and screws/nuts from your local hardware store. Here's the back of my bumper w/ a Teg lip installed. You'll have to do some drilling on the bottom of your bumper.

The overall length of the piece is almost perfect - but there is a slight diference in the shape. As long as you mount it to enough points and pull it in good and tight it is not too difficult to make it look nice.Originally Posted by EX-ileAccord
oh yeah - and i would highly recommend taking your bumper off to install it - it will make things MUCH easier. You'll save more time than it takes to take it off and put it back on.
